ATA_FLUSHCACHE failing
Søren Schmidt
sos at DeepCore.dk
Wed May 5 23:42:51 PDT 2004
Anthony Ginepro wrote:
>>Mark Santcroos wrote:
>>>>We should find out why it does not return, my guess is that
>>>>it doesn't interrupt and the timeout doesn't fire because we are on the
>>>>way down...
>>>
>>>Any hints where to start looking?
>>>
>>>I'll keep investigating myself too.
>>
>>Hmm, first you could enable the ATA request debug code in ata-all.h,
>>then set the ATA_R_DEBUG flag when the flush command is issued. That
>>should give an idea where it goes south...
> I tried what Mark suggested and finally kernel dumps work now.
> Here is my dmesg attached for more information.
Something popped into mind, the addump routine does a flush when its
done dumping, from the description so far its not clear to me if it
hangs *before* the dump starts or hangs when it about finished ?
--
-Søren
More information about the freebsd-current
mailing list